@media screen and (max-width: 930px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 850px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 768px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(min-width: 766px) and (max-width: 767px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media only screen and (max-width: 576px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media only screen and (max-width: 500px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 520px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 420px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 414px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 375px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}

@media screen and (max-width: 320px){
    .faq-section p{
        font-size: 14px;
    }

    .faq-section .card-body{
        padding: .5rem;
        font-size: 14px;
    }
}
